NEET 2021 Question Paper with Answer Key PDF in English P2

NEET 2021 Question paper in the English language was prepared for 24 different codes. Other than that, NEET 2021 question paper was also prepared in 12 other languages like Hindi, Marathi, Tamil, etc. It must be noted that the difficulty level, type of questions, and pattern of the paper were the same in all the paper codes.

  • Physics was the most difficult section of the paper. The majority of questions were framed from Electrodynamics (20 Questions) and Mechanics (14 Questions). 
  • Chemistry was the easiest section of the paper. Organic Chemistry, Inorganic Chemistry, and Physical Chemistry had roughly equal weightage in the paper. 
  • The Biology sections- Zoology and Botany were average in difficulty. Dominant units in the sections were - Human physiology (12 Questions), and Genetics (11 Questions), and Plant Physiology (8 Questions).

NEET 2021 P2 Paper Analysis

As per test-takers NEET 2021 was moderately difficult with Physics section being the most difficult and tricky. 

  • NEET Chemistry section was moderate in terms of difficulty with Inorganic Chemistry having the maximum weightage.
  • NEET Physics had more numerical-based questions than last year. Topics that had the maximum weightage were Electrostatistics, Electricity, and Mechanics.
  • Questions asked in NEET Botany were easy-moderate with maximum questions being direct fact-based.
  • NEET Zoology was rated moderate to tough.
